Requirements

  • 4 years of experience as a corporate, commercial, or military pilot
  • Holds a valid Airline Transport Pilot License and a valid Instrument Rating for the category of aircraft operated
  • Must maintain PIC qualifications on at least one type of company aircraft
  • Knowledge of the content of the Aviation Operations Manual, Training Manuals, Standard Operating Procedures, and the provisions of Titles 14 and 49 of the CFRs and standards necessary to carry out the duties and responsibilities of the position
  • Must be able to demonstrate the ability to lift 40 pounds to shoulder level due to baggage loading and unloading requirements

Nice To Haves

  • Holds a type rating or qualification for at least one of the following helicopters: S-76 or H-160
  • Bachelor's degree

Responsibilities

  • Conduct safe, efficient flight operations in accordance with all applicable CFRs, the AIM, AFM, the Constellation AOM, and applicable country/local regulations.
  • Supervise the copilot/SIC and other crewmembers assigned to the trip.
  • Provide excellent customer service.
  • Be solutions focused and communicate with other members of the Transportation Department, the company, and outside vendors as needed to accomplish assigned trips.
  • Carry primary responsibility for the safe transportation of passengers and additional crewmembers and emphasize a strong safety culture within the Transportation Department.
  • Participate in safety meetings, incident debriefings, and implement safety recommendations.
  • Comply with all security protocols to protect passengers, crew, and the aircraft, and remain prepared to handle emergency situations in flight or on the ground.
  • Maintain a working knowledge of the Emergency Response Plan and apply the correct initial response actions during emergency drills or actual emergencies.
  • Participate in the Safety Management System (SMS) by complying with all regulations, safety best practices, and industry protocols.
  • Utilize the Safety Report process, Continuous Improvement process, and other procedures to ensure a healthy safety culture exists within the Transportation Department.
  • Assist the Chief Pilot in ensuring all flights and flight crew members adhere to relevant aviation regulations, company policies, and standard operating procedures.
  • Train and evaluate flight crew members, including pilots and other operational personnel.
  • Provide technical guidance and support, oversee training programs and records, offer ongoing coaching and feedback, conduct performance evaluations, and foster a positive work environment.
  • Maintain accurate and comprehensive records in the CRM for all business development activities.
  • Identify opportunities for process improvements, cost reductions, and increased efficiency within flight operations.
  • Implement new technologies, training programs, or best practices to enhance productivity and safety.
  • Accept and perform additional duties as assigned by the Chief Pilot.
